Los Angeles, CA - As autumn flavors sweep across the nation, popular warehouse club Costco has once again introduced its seasonal pumpkin streusel muffins, drawing attention from consumers and content creators alike. Local influencer 'The Lavelle Show' recently shared his unboxing and taste-test experience with the highly anticipated baked goods. In a video uploaded on September 19, 2025, the creator, known for his engaging reviews, showcased a pack of eight large muffins, noting their distinctive streusel topping. He highlighted the product's affordability, stating the entire pack cost only $7, making each muffin less than a dollar. Joined by an off-camera companion referred to as 'Big Guy,' the duo meticulously evaluated the muffins. They described the texture as dense yet moist, with a sweetness that was not overpowering. While 'The Lavelle Show' expressed clear enjoyment, 'Big Guy' offered a critical perspective, rating the muffin a 7 out of 10 and suggesting it might be better suited as a slice of bread or cake.
